The hallmark of the best version of Micrografx Designer was its focus on technical accuracy. It provided a very sophisticated vector illustration environment that offered many of the capabilities found in a CAD program. This included features like object snap for perfect alignment, automatic dimensioning, and support for 64 layers, allowing for complex, multi-faceted technical drawings. For engineers, architects, and technical illustrators, this was a massive advantage over standard graphic design software.

It featured automatic dimensioning lines that updated dynamically as objects were resized.
Unlike standard vector tools where you had to manually draw and label dimension lines, Designer 9 featured intelligent, automatic dimensioning. If you resized a gear, a wall, or a mechanical part, the dimension labels updated automatically. It supported linear, angular, radial, and diametric dimensioning to exact geometric tolerances. 2. To understand why version 9 is considered the "best," we must understand the company. Micrografx was a Texas-based software house founded in 1982. For a while, they were Microsoft’s biggest competitor in the diagramming space (Visio vs. Micrografx Flowcharter). But their crown jewel was . The hallmark of the best version of Micrografx
The most reliable way to run Designer 9 is to set up a virtual machine using free software like VirtualBox. Install a copy of Windows XP or Windows 7 inside the virtual machine to create a perfect sandbox environment for the software.
